Profession as a secular Franciscan involves a conscious choice to shape one's life around the core ideals of poverty, humility, and simplicity.
The profession signifies a commitment to living in harmony with all of creation and making a positive impact on the world.
The process of formation and discernment prepares individuals for their profession and deepens their understanding of the Franciscan way of life.
Professed secular Franciscans have responsibilities to live a life of poverty, humility, and simplicity, actively participate in their Franciscan community, and be witnesses to the gospel in their daily lives.
Being a professed secular Franciscan offers the benefits of a deeper sense of purpose, a supportive community, and opportunities for personal and spiritual growth.
